Description
This method is one of a series for evaluating the sound insulating properties of building elements.
It is designed to measure the impact sound transmission performance of an isolated floor-ceiling assembly, in a controlled laboratory environment.
Scope
This method covers the laboratory measurement of impact sound transmission of floor-ceiling assemblies, wherein it is assumed that the test specimen constitutes the primary sound transmission path into a receiving room located directly below and in which there exists a diffuse sound field.
Measurements may be conducted on floor-ceiling assemblies of all kinds, including those with floating-floor or suspended ceiling elements, or both, and floor-ceiling assemblies surfaced with any type of floor-surfacing or floor-covering materials.
This method further prescribes:
-
A uniform method of reporting laboratory test data, that is, the normalized onethird octave band sound pressure levels transmitted by the floor-ceiling assembly due to the tapping machine, and
-
A single-figure classification rating, "Impact Insulation Class, IIC" that can be used by architects, builders, and specification and code authorities for acoustical design purposes in building construction. The IIC is obtained by matching a standard reference contour to the plotted normalized one-third octave band sound pressure levels at each test frequency obtained.
